Hello,
I thought in the T930 , the FMW PLT format is not support, can you share with me the purpose ?
meantime you can update the firmware with :
Firmware updates can be performed in the following ways:
- Using the Embedded Web Server (type the IP address of the printer from any Web browser as Internet Explorer), select the Setup tab and then Maintenance > Firmware update and then select manual firmware update tab.
- Click on browse button to point to the newer firmware file (.fmw).
- Click on the update button and follow the instructions
- Using the HP Designjet Utility under Windows, select the Admin tab and then Firmware Update.
- Using the HP Utility under Mac OS X, select Firmware Update.
- Using a USB flash drive. Download the firmware file into the USB flash drive and insert it into the Hi-Speed USB host port in the front panel. A firmware update assistant will appear on the front panel to guide you through the update process.
